Xiaomi Issues 0.40 Million Class B Shares for Equity Incentives, Buys Back 3.70 Million Shares for HK$97.40 Million

Xiaomi Corporation (Xiaomi) filed a Next Day Disclosure Return (10 June 2026) detailing marginal share issuance for employee incentives alongside an ongoing on-market buyback program.

New share issuance • On 9–10 June 2026 Xiaomi issued a total of 396,800 Class B weighted‐voting-right (WVR) ordinary shares to non-director participants under its share scheme. • The shares were allotted at HK$2.27 (131,600 shares) and HK$2.47 (265,200 shares), implying a volume-weighted average issue price of roughly HK$2.40. • The new shares expanded the Class B share base by 0.0015%, lifting the total number of issued Class B shares to 21.39 billion. Total issued shares (Class A + B) stood at 25.84 billion as of 8 June 2026.

Latest share repurchase • On 10 June 2026 Xiaomi repurchased 3.70 million Class B shares on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ange at prices between HK$26.26 and HK$26.38, for an aggregate HK$97.40 million. • These shares are earmarked for cancellation under the repurchase mandate approved on 2 June 2026, which authorises up to 2.58 billion shares for buyback.

Cumulative repurchase activity (27 Apr – 10 Jun 2026) • Shares repurchased for cancellation but not yet cancelled total 72.11 million Class B shares, representing approximately 0.28% of the company’s total issued share capital. • Purchase prices across the period ranged from HK$26.32 to HK$31.52 per share.

Mandate utilisation and moratorium • Since the 2 June 2026 mandate was granted, Xiaomi has repurchased 14.30 million shares, equivalent to 0.06% of the issued share base at the mandate date. • In line with Hong Kong listing rules, the company is barred from issuing new shares or disposing of treasury shares until 10 July 2026 following these repurchases.

Capital structure snapshot (post-issuance, pre-cancellation) • Class B shares outstanding: 21.39 billion • Class A shares outstanding: 4.45 billion • Total shares outstanding: 25.84 billion

The disclosed actions indicate Xiaomi’s concurrent use of targeted equity incentives and an active buyback program within the parameters approved by shareholders and the Hong Kong Stock Exchange.
